HeLIUM ANALYZER The ATOMOX HeLIUM ANALYZER® (Image) operates by comparing the thermal conductivity of the sample gas to the thermal conductivity of a reference gas housed in a sealed cell. This technique to determine helium was first reported in the scientific literature in 1908 and is still used today. Improvisation (e.g. "rule of thumb", "fudge factor") and experimentation are no longer necessary when mixing gases with helium. Knowing the helium content of a mix eliminates an unknown and will allow the user to keep better track of their gas blending skills. Having an accurate (within 1%) reading of the helium content allows better decompression planning, and can enhance diver safety. The greatest benefit of the analyzer will be realized in gas blending operations. The analyzer will allow the use of continuous gas blending of trimix when combined with an oxygen analyzer. FEATURES: • The unit can be used for mixes of N2/O2 (Air) and He. • Determines volumetric helium content of 0% to 100% with an error of +/- 1%. • Simple hands-free operation. • The gas mixture is continuously sampled and updated every second, after the initial warm-up period. • Powered by rechargeable NiMH battery pack that provides 12+ hours of operation. • Can also be powered with a supplied DC power supply (wall transformer) even when the battery pack is being charged. • The sensor is packaged as a complete, flameproof gas detection head in a stainless steel enclosure. A high oxygen content gas (up to 100%) will not explode or ignite. • The sensor is extremely robust, once calibrated it rarely falls out of calibration and needs little to no maintenance. • The expected life of the sensor is greater than 10 years. • The ambient operating temperature range is 5oC to 40oC, (41oF to 104oF); Storage temperature is -20oC to 60oC (-4oF to 140oF). • The total unit is enclosed in a rugged Pelican 1150 case and is easily portable. The outside dimensions of the case are 7.75W x 9.25L x 4.5H. .
